A devastating airstrike in Kabul, Afghanistan, has reportedly killed at least 100 people at a drug rehabilitation centre, according to early reports. Authorities and international observers are investigating claims that the attack was carried out by Pakistani forces, though official confirmation from all sides is still awaited.

The strike has sparked widespread concern across the region, with humanitarian groups warning about the impact on civilians and vulnerable populations receiving treatment at the facility.


Kabul Drug Rehab Centre Airstrike Leaves Dozens Dead

The Kabul drug rehab centre airstrike reportedly struck a facility that was treating individuals struggling with drug addiction. Rescue teams rushed to the scene to search for survivors and assist the injured.

Local officials said many of the victims were patients undergoing rehabilitation. The attack has raised serious questions about the safety of civilian medical and rehabilitation centres during regional conflicts.


Pakistan Airstrike Allegations and Regional Tensions

Reports suggesting a Pakistan airstrike in Kabul have intensified tensions between Afghanistan and Pakistan. While some Afghan officials have blamed cross-border military action, Pakistani authorities have not yet confirmed the allegations.

Experts say such incidents could escalate diplomatic tensions and raise concerns about cross-border military operations in the region.
